`
sakakokiya
  • 浏览: 507015 次
  • 性别: Icon_minigender_1
  • 来自: 北京
社区版块
存档分类
最新评论

设计模式的基本要素是什么?

阅读更多
设计模式基本要素为:模式名称、问题、解决方案和效果。
•    模式名称:一个助记名称,用来描述设计模式、解决方案和效果。
•    问题:主要描述在何时使用设计模式。
•    解决方案:描述了设计的组成成分、它们之间的相互关系及各自的职责和协作方式
•    效果:描述了模式应用的效果和使用模式权衡的问题。
分享到:
评论

相关推荐

    软件设计模式(java版)习题答案.pdf

    设计模式一般有如下几个基本要素:模式名称、问题、目的、解决方案、效果、实例代码和相关设计模式,其中的关键元素包括模式名称、问题、解决方案和效果。 设计模式的优点 正确使用设计模式具有以下优点: 1. ...

    设计模式 中文 书籍

    2. **模式的组成要素**:文中提到了设计模式的四个基本要素: - **模式名称**:模式的名称通常是简洁明了的,能够概括该模式的关键特征。例如,“单例模式”、“工厂模式”等。 - **问题**:明确指出该模式所针对...

    C++设计模式电子书

    设计模式是面向对象思想的集大成,GOF在其经典著作中总结了23种设计模式,又可分为:创建型、结构型和行为型3个大类。对于软件设计者来说,一般的过程就是在熟练掌握语言背景的基础上,了解类库的大致框架和常用的...

    java设计模式&java程序设计

    #### 一、设计模式的概念与构成要素 设计模式是一种被广泛接受的解决方案,用于解决软件设计中的常见问题。这种解决方案已经被反复验证为有效的,因此在软件开发过程中非常实用。设计模式可以帮助开发者更好地组织...

    设计模式代码和报告

    外观模式 其他模式了解软件设计模式的概念、原则、分类及构成的基本要素。 2. 使学生了解23种设计模式,归纳总结创建型模式、行为型模式和结构型模式的应用情景、所需角色。并根据分类各举一例详细说明要析 3. 使...

    四人帮设计模式

    设计模式由四个基本要素构成,分别是模式名称、问题、解决方案和效果。模式名称是一个助记名,便于人们交流和理解;问题描述了设计应该解决的问题,通常包括设计的上下文和问题的约束条件;解决方案则描述了设计的...

    软件设计模式

    设计模式的基本要素包括名称、意图、问题、解决方案、参与者和协作者、效果、以及实现GOF参考。遵循的原则有开闭原则(对扩展开放,对修改关闭)、从场景进行设计、优先组合原则(优先使用对象组合而非类继承)和...

    设计模式(中文版).pdf

    #### 四、设计模式的构成要素 每个设计模式通常由以下几个关键组成部分构成: 1. **模式名称**:简短且易于记忆的名字,用于描述模式所解决的问题、提供的解决方案以及带来的效果。这有助于开发者在更高层次上进行...

    head first 设计模式 中文版带书签

    设计模式通常包含三个基本要素:模式名称、问题描述以及解决方案。在《Head First设计模式》这本书中,作者通过易于理解的方式介绍了23种经典的设计模式,并提供了大量的实例来帮助读者理解和应用这些模式。 ### 二...

    设计模式之实战

    以上是设计模式的基本概念及其分类。在实战应用中,每种模式的适用条件、实现方式和与其他模式的关系都是需要仔细考量的。例如,在简单工厂模式中,当需要根据不同的输入参数创建不同类型的对象时,可以通过switch...

    深入浅出设计模式之附录A

    - **设计模式与面向对象编程原则的关系**:解释设计模式是如何基于面向对象编程的基本原则构建的,以及它们如何相互影响和支持。 - **最佳实践建议**:给出在实际开发过程中如何有效地使用设计模式的一些建议和技巧...

    常用设计模式及Java程序 pdf

    设计模式通常包含以下四个基本要素: 1. **模式名称**:简洁明了的名字,便于记忆和引用。 2. **问题**:定义了何时使用模式的背景环境,包括设计问题的原因和后果。 3. **解决方案**:阐述了解决问题所需的组件、...

    设计模式基础学习 各种软件设计模式

    一个设计模式通常包含以下基本要素: - **模式名称**:一个简洁的名称,概括了模式的问题、解决方案和效果,增加设计词汇量,促进高级抽象层面的设计讨论。 - **问题**:描述模式试图解决的具体问题。 - **解决方案...

    设计模式PPT

    接下来,我们深入探讨设计模式的基本构成要素: 1. **模式名称**:是模式的标识,帮助我们识别和记忆模式,同时也用于在设计讨论和文档中引用。 2. **问题**:描述了模式适用的场景,解释了需要解决的设计问题及其...

    图解设计模式 ,结城浩著 学习笔记

    设计模式通常包含三个基本要素:模式名称、问题描述和解决方案。 ### 设计模式的分类 设计模式大致可以分为三大类:创建型模式、结构型模式和行为型模式。 - **创建型模式**关注于对象的创建机制,使创建过程变得...

    设计模式面面观(10):桥接模式(Bridge Pattern)-结构型模式

    设计模式之我见(1):设计模式概述 (100%) 设计模式面面观(2):设计模式基本要素与原则 (100%) 设计模式面面观(3):单件模式(Singletion)-创建型模式 (100%) 设计模式面面观(4):工厂模式...

Global site tag (gtag.js) - Google Analytics